## Authentication

The Fernwheel render benchmarks hit the Tallowby template service directly. Cold renders should stay under 40ms; anything slower means the partial cache missed. Auth is a single bearer key, scoped read-only, rotated monthly. Don't reuse it outside the benchmark harness — rate limits are tuned for one client. Requests without it get a 401 with no body. Use the staging key below for all local runs.

service key, yadup-tagag: kto2_62

Hey team — handing off the Spoolhopper printer-spooler service to Darna while I'm out. It's stable, but the retry queue occasionally jams after firmware pushes; just bounce the worker pod. Dashboards are under the Inkline folder. If the admin console locks you out during a restart, you'll need to re-enter the service recovery passphrase, which is:

vault phrase of bagaf-kajeg = jorath-feniel-briir-siliel-ralix

Handing off the Quillbus broker upgrade (4.x to 5.1) to Dario. Cluster is half-migrated; mixed-version mode is supported but TLS cert rotation must finish before cutover. No auth model changes, though the admin API gained two new endpoints worth reviewing. Open questions and the migration checklist are tracked on the internal page below.

dashboard of taduf-bawef = https://jira.lumicsys.internal/projects/display/browse/b1cbf89d